Automotive Electric Power Steering Market size was valued at USD 25.09 billion in 2022 and is poised to grow from USD 26.55 billion in 2023 to USD 41.67 billion by 2031, growing at a CAGR of 5.52% in the forecast period (2024-2032).

Rising Integration of Advanced Sensor Technologies: The tremendous shift towards the improvement and integration of steer-via-twine era, removing the need for a physical connection between the steering wheel and the wheels. This fashion complements layout flexibility and opens avenues for advanced driving force-assistance systems. Additionally, the enterprise is experiencing a multiplied attention on software program-primarily based enhancements, considering customizable steering experience and reaction. Another rising trend is the integration of Artificial Intelligence (AI) and system studying algorithms to optimize guidance manage and adapt to various driving situations.

Asia-Pacific is likely to dominate the market. The vicinity is a hub for automotive production, with essential economies like China, Japan, and South Korea playing key roles. The high manufacturing volumes of cars in Asia-Pacific, coupled with the increasing adoption of electric electricity steerage structures with the aid of automakers, contribute to the region's dominance.
